1. Ed Sheeran
The hugely popular young singer and songwriter was born in Halifax, with his early childhood home located in nearby Hebden Bridge. He began playing guitar from a young age and showed a lot of promise. Photo: Shutterstock
2. Jeremy Clarkson
Best known for his stint presenting the hit BBC car series Top Gear, the broadcaster and journalist hails from Doncaster, and attended Hill House School and Repton School as a youngster. Photo: Shutterstock
3. Matthew Lewis
Famed for portraying Neville Longbottom in the Harry Potter film series, Leeds-born Matthew Lewis was raised in the nearby town of Horsforth, where he attended St Mary's Menston Catholic Voluntary Academy. Photo: Shutterstock
4. Gabby Logan
The British presenter and former international rhythmic gymnast was also born in Leeds and is best known for presenting on BBC Sport and ITV. She now lives in Kew in southwest London with her husband Kenny Logan. Photo: Clive Brunskill
